A few years ago, I bought a Kenmore window unit air conditioner that touted being smart, app-controlled, and able to connect to Alexa and Google Home. After Kev had securely installed the AC in my office window, I powered it on only to find that the app and smart features were incompatible with my WiFi mesh system. :facepalm: Long story short, for the past three years, I’ve had an otherwise excellent window unit that’s never lived up to its potential. However, that all changed when I received a Cielo Breez Plus review unit; with it, my AC is finally smart!

Vizio currently offers several television lines; their OLED line starts at $1299.99, the P-Series starts at $1199.99 for a 65” television, and a 40″ M-Series starts at $399.99. By contrast, you can get a 40” V-Series television for just $229.99. The V705x-H1, which I was sent for review, has an MSRP of $659.99 and is currently available for $549.99.
